> >>> Etienne, Gaël,
> >>>
> >>> As you might know, Spacebel has some internal development in the
> >>> field of
> >>> UML to «embedded C» code generation and reverse engineering of
> >>> legacy C
> >>> codes to UML models.
> >>> Generated C code does not depend on any runtime and does not
> >>> allocate
> >>> memory. Generation is driven by some stereotypes and support
> >>> target
> >>> specific constructions.
> >>> This generation based on Acceleo and has been integrated into
> >>> Papyrus and
> >>> latest Obeo UML Designer.
> >>> In order to complete the picture we should also consider an Ada
> >>> generator.

> >>>> Hi everyone,
> >>>>
> >>>> As Paul Arberet explain at the previous Polarsys meeting, a new
> >>>> project
> >>>> will be propose: UML Generators.
> >>>> This project is proposed under the umbrella of Eclipse Modeling,
> >>>> but it
> >>>> should interest Polarsys members.
> >>>>
> >>>> Here is an extract :
> >>>> ---------------------
> >>>>
> >>>> The initial contribution provides five generators:
> >>>>
> >>>> *   UML2Java: It  converts Class and State diagrams into Java
> >>>> code.
> >>>> *   UML2C: It converts Class and State diagrams into C code.
> >>>> *   C2UML: It reverses C code into a UML model.
> >>>> *   UML2RTSJ : It converts Structure Composite, Class and State
> >>>> diagrams
> >>>> into Java code based on RTSJ (Real Time Specification for Java).
> >>>>     *   The generated code is organized according to a
> >>>>     Components Based
> >>>> Architecture.
> >>>>     *   The UML model is enhanced by a UML profile to add
> >>>>     real-time
> >>>> properties and it is decorated by a DSL to specify the kind of
> >>>> communication between each component.
> >>>> *   Java2UML: It reverses Java code to a UML model.
> >>>>
> >>>> The scope is any generator which consumes or produces UML
> >>>> models.
